
Government was fully aware of Eurogroup decision behorehand
Written statement of Georgos Loucaides, AKEL C.C. Press Office Spokesperson,
31st March 2014, Nicosia
The Deputy Government Spokesman tried today to refute all that Eurogroup President Jeroen Dijsselbloem mentined to Parliament’s Finance Committee with regards the decision for the haircut on bank deposits and more specifically concerning the fact that the Anastasiades government was informed and knew about it from the 4th March 2013.
We once again call upon the government and the President of the Republic to find the political courage and finally admit the truth about the events that preceded the Eurogroup decision, namely, that the Anastasiades government was fully informed about the Troika’s demand for a haircut/levy on bank deposits, but never informed the political leadership.
We reiterate that such an action on the one hand will restore the truth, whilst on the other will end the endless discussion and political confrontation, contributing to the effort to restore people’s perception of institutions and political involvement.
